Miiryn presents MIKROS

Curated by Miiryn, MIKROS is a mini-festival of concerts presenting new and experimental music by a variety of independent artists from Chicago, Montreal, and New York. Performances will take place at different venues in New York for 4 consecutive days and will feature diverse interpretations of new music and improvisations.
